In September 2025, Good Life X came to Vavuniya and Mannar with a question: what does regenerative business look like in the North of Sri Lanka?

What we found were eight women already doing the work โ€” farming organically, crafting by hand, baking from scratch, creating with purpose.

๐Ÿงต AN Fashion: Transforming fabric waste into new product lines
๐Ÿ‘œ PJ Bag Manufacturing: Eco-friendly bag producer with a growing export demand
๐ŸŒฑ PN Agri: Award-winning organic farm growing fruits and vegetables
๐Ÿชก ST Creation: Aari embroidery business, keeping a rare and beautiful craft alive ๐ŸŒฟ Ashwin Products: Ayurvedic and herbal care brand rooted in traditional knowledge
๐ŸŽ‚ Dilani's Delight Cakes: Beloved local bakery known for its craftsmanship
๐ŸŒพ Good Life: Organic food brand sourced directly from farmers in the North
๐ŸŒด Kala Palmyra Production Centre: 20-year-old palmyrah-based craft enterprise

With the support of our partners at WUSC under the GRIT Project, the businesses participated in THRIVE Masterclasses, Design Labs, business diagnostics, expert mentorship, alumni visits, and community events that brought the Northern startup ecosystem together. These eight entrepreneurs came out with clearer direction, stronger networks, and regenerative business models that are more ready for what's next.
